…ifit Jr:A: .L.-40.6s SEPHARDIC PRIDE from page 63 through generations, many Sephardic Jews can trace their roots farther back than Ashkenazic Jews," says Belinfante. He can document his family back to 1492, when Jews were expelled from Spain. "Also, Ashkenazic Jews didn't start looking into genealogy in full force until the last 100 years, while Sephardic Jews have typically kept more complete records," he says. …11..• T AL..JAT Ar pr it i 1 1 . , 0 We are Are You Puzzled? pleased to announce The World Of Paul Ehrlich Paul Ehrlich (1854-1915) was a German Jewish bacteriologist. In 1908, he received the Nobel Prize in Medicine arid physiology for his Work on immunity and serum therapy.
